Program Scout Report

Overview

Riviera Preparatory School operates as an independent program in Florida's competitive prep basketball landscape. With a foundation dating back to 1950 and state championship pedigree, the program has established itself as a destination for developing high-level talent outside traditional conference structures.

Player Development

Riviera Prep demonstrates strong player development with multiple nationally-ranked prospects currently on roster. The program's track record includes producing college-ready athletes, with current players like Quincy Douby Jr. and Myles Fuentes positioned as top-100 national recruits in their respective classes.

Recruiting Outlook

The program currently features impressive talent depth with four nationally-tracked players, including three top-100 prospects in the 2027 class. This concentration of elite talent, anchored by Quincy Douby Jr. and Myles Fuentes, positions Riviera Prep as a rising force in prep basketball with strong momentum in recruiting circles.
